Italy Closes Borders with Spain at Ports and Airports

Africa1 hr ago

Italy's Ministry of the Interior has ordered the closure of its borders with Spain at all ports and airports. The decision was announced by the Italian news agency ANSA. This measure will impact travel and trade between the two European Union member states. Further details regarding the specific duration or conditions of this border closure have not yet been released. The ministry's directive signifies a significant step in managing cross-border movement between Italy and Spain.
